Sauti Sol are an influential Kenyan Afro-pop vocal group whose rich harmonic blend, organic arrangements, and message-driven songwriting helped set them apart from other African acts at the end of the 2000s. Beginning with 2009's Mwanzo, they consistently charted their own course, infusing traditional Kenyan styles and rhythms with upbeat melodic pop and mixing edgy themes of police violence and political corruption with smooth R&B-flavored love songs, earning numerous awards and a multitude of fans in the process.
